The golden age of comics ended in the mid-1950s due to the decrease in the popularity of comic books. The decrease in popularity had to do with the ending of World War II as well as comics being blamed for a rise in juvenile crimes. To address these public concerns, the Comics Code Authority was created. After the comic book industry saw an influx of horror and romance books, superheroes took their place at the forefront of the industry in 1956. The Showcase #4 comic, featuring the Flash, is regarded as the first comic in the silver age of comics that spanned from 1956-1970. Showcase #4 is notable for being the first-ever appearance of the Flash, the popular DC superhero. This comic was released in 1956, as the golden age of comic books was ending. Many people believe this comic book was the start of the silver age of comics from 1956-1970. A copy of Showcase #4 with a grade of 9.6/10 was sold in 2009 for $179,250.
